PDA

Visualizza la versione completa : Se il recordset è vuoto?


kleila
19-09-2002, 10:03
Ciao a tutti!!!
Ho un problema con una maschera di access che visualizza un elenco di interventi. In questa maschera posso effettuare delle ricerche come ad esempio per centro assistenza e per perido, ma quando non trovo alcuna informazione, vorrei che mi apparisse una msgbox avvertendomi che non ci sono record per i parametri selezionati. Come si fa il controllo?
Gli passo i criteri e la miasql così:
RecordSource = miasql
Grazie mille a tutti!!!

al79it
19-09-2002, 12:20
crei le applicazioni con codice o con macro??
Se le crei in codice non vedo il pb, una volta creato il recordset basta fare il classico controllo:
if rst.eof then
msgbox("blablabla")
else
...
end if

kleila
19-09-2002, 12:27
Nel mio caso non uso recordset (passo i criteri alla
miasql e poi assegno alla proprietà Recordsource l'origine dei dati), ma ho trovato la soluzione per verificare la presenza o meno di record ho usato questa condizione:

If Recordset.Clone.EOF and RecordsetClone.BOF then MSGBOX "nessun record trovato"

grazie, lo stesso!

:ciauz:

Loading